About Banyan Software

Banyan Software provides a permanent home for successful enterprise software companies, their employees, and their customers. Our mission is to acquire, build, and grow great enterprise software businesses that hold leading positions in niche vertical markets around the world.

Banyan has been recognized as the #1 fastest-growing private software company in the U.S. on the Inc. 5000 and ranked among the top ten fastest-growing companies on the Deloitte Technology Fast 500.

Founded in 2016, Banyan operates with a permanent capital base designed to preserve the legacy of founders. We follow a long-term, buy-and-hold-for-life strategy, focused on growing software companies that serve specialized vertical markets.

Beware of Recruitment Scams

We have been made aware of individuals fraudulently posing as members of our Talent Acquisition team and extending fake job offers. These scams may involve requests for personal information or payment for equipment. 

Protect yourself by following these steps:

  • Verify that all communications from our recruiting team come from an @banyansoftware.com email address.
  • Remember, employers will never request payment or banking information during the hiring process.
  • If you receive a suspicious message, do not respond — instead, forward it to [email protected] and/or report it to the platform where you received it.

Your safety and security are important to us. Thank you for staying vigilant.
